Quick orientation for the Stockweave reconciliation job: it runs nightly, diffs warehouse counts against the ledger, and queues mismatches for human review instead of auto-correcting (we learned that the hard way). Don't worry about the scheduler internals yet — you'll mostly touch the thresholds that decide what counts as a mismatch worth flagging. Here are the constants it currently runs with.

limits module of tafop-hahop:
WEIGHTS = {
    "julmir": 223,
    "belox": 987,
    "lamion": 470,
    "pelath": 609,
    "fraok": 1010,
    "eliion": 343,
    "drudor": 342,
}

Present: all department heads. Apologies: none.

1. Renewal with Tarnbeck Assurance approved. Premium increase of 6% accepted; broker to confirm terms by month-end.
2. Flood coverage for the Ellersby warehouse extended; excess unchanged.
3. Claims history reviewed — two minor incidents, both settled.
4. Risk register to be updated by operations before next meeting.
5. Facilities to schedule the annual site inspection.

Meeting closed on time. The confidential note on forthcoming business plans follows below.

confidential, kagap-kajeg: Istethax Holdings is in early talks to buy Ulaielix Works for about $23.7 million. The Lamys launch date is July 6, and nothing goes to the press before then.

## Approvals — Brindlemark PDF Invoice Renderer

Any change to the invoice renderer requires a staged approval. First, run the golden-file comparison suite and attach the diff report. Second, a peer must verify currency rounding and page-break behavior on the long-line fixtures. Template changes additionally need a layout review in the staging viewer. Final sign-off on every renderer release is held by one person.

account owner for bawip-tahag: Raleth Quenok

Quarterly Planning Note — Insurance Renewal
Team: our property and liability policies with Ashgrove Mutual renew next quarter. Premiums are quoted up about 9%, mostly from the Larkfield warehouse expansion. We're testing two alternative carriers before committing. Please send updated asset lists by the 15th so cover limits are right. Broker meeting is booked. Context on why this matters strategically follows below.

board note of tadup-tajog: Headcount on the Oliiel team goes from 31 to 88 by the end of February. Gross margin on Oliiel came in at 62 percent against a plan of 29 percent.